Research directions of Network and Security Research Lab. (NetLab), founded at Korea University and currently affiliated with the College of IT Convergence at Gachon University, are spanned in, but are not limited to, RF-Powered Computing and Networking, Mobile Telecommunications, Design and Implementation of Networked Systems, and Network Security.
